    One of the biggest myths in sales and marketing is that all one needs in order to bring customers running to any given door, or website, or service delivery point is a catchy name.

    I have no idea where this belief came from, but it's time for it to die the slow, horrible death is deserves.

    In order to connect your proposed service with the desired outcome you're offering you need to first of all define the identity of your ideal customer, why they ought to care about your service, and to pinpoint the single most important benefit FOR THEM as to why they ought to do business with you and not with someone else. So, is there a MARKET for this kind of offering?

    If there is, GREAT! But before you get too excited about a name, figure out the profit potential for the markets you plan to tap. I'm urging you to do this because without dedicated buyers you'll have no revenue streams.

    To do this you might want to first figure out
    which specific individuals WITHIN the college and corporate world make up your target audience.

    One of the things you mentioned was "I require a Fresh name that attracts attention and is very Corporate as well."

    What EXACTLY is a "fresh" name?

    If one of your targets is the college environment, why must your name be "very corporate"?

    If you plan on creating a niche by only doing sporting events (for cricket or soccer events), your niche will stop being a niche if and when go into other sports. In the first instance, rather than trying to do cricket AND soccer, do just one and get really good at everything to do with that one sport and THEN branch out from there.

    And how will your planned event company create its revenue streams? Sponsorships? Advertising? On a fee per match basis? On a league basis? And if it's competition-based and you offer sponsors a certain amount of visibility, how will you DELIVER that visibility in terms of eyeballs, backsides on seats, or by bodies through the turnstiles?

    Figure all this out and the name becomes secondary.
    Figure all this out and the name can be the sponsor's name (if you plan on attracting a sponsor), giving you a name along the lines of "The ABC Company International Cricket League Trophy".

    That's the other thing: every top class sporting event of this nature offers some form of competitive edge or recognition, some THING (trophy, award, recognition, prize, whatever) for teams to win. Without a goal, without an end in sight or some kind of prize there is little to aspire to.
